Using the supplied screws, secure the four 
protective feet (packed separately) into the 
threaded inserts at each corner of the 
cabinet’s bottom.

You can connect your PRO-SW200P to an 
amplifier/receiver’s subwoofer out or pre 
out jacks or speaker terminals.

Notes:

• You can connect your PRO-SW200P 

to your TV if it has variable line out 
jacks.

• See “Connecting to Subwoofer Out or 

Pre Out Terminals” or “Connecting to 
Speaker Terminals.” 

Caution:

 To avoid any damage to the 

subwoofer or amplifier, disconnect power 
from your components before making any 
connections.

Use this connection if your amplifier/
receiver has jacks labeled SUBWOOFER 
OUT or PRE OUT. Do not use the PRE 
OUT jacks if they are already connected by 
cables or jumpers to your amplifier.

1. Connect the PRO-SW200P’s 

LOW

 

LEVEL

 

INPUT

 jacks to the amplifier/

receiver’s line sub out or pre out jacks 
(or TV’s audio line out jacks). 

2. Connect your satellite speakers (if 

any) to the amplifier’s or receiver’s 
output terminals as they would 
normally be connected.

Notes:

• On some receivers/amplifiers, the 

subwoofer out is a single jack. Use a 
single phono cable to connect the 
subwoofer jack to the “L” input on the 
PRO-SW200P. 

• When connecting to a TV, we 

recommend using variable line output 
jacks, which will allow the PRO-
SW200P’s volume to change with the 
TV’s volume. Refer to your TV owner’s 
manual. Also, you can connect to the 
TV line out and then adjust the TV 
volume up or down. If the subwoofer 
volume changes with the TV volume, 
then the TV line out is variable.
